About Yuzhou Wang
Yuzhou Wang is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 63 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Concrete Corrosion and Durability (12 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(6 papers), Corrosion Behavior and Inhibition (6 papers), Infrastructure Maintenance and Monitoring (6 papers), Concrete and Cement Materials Research (5 papers),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(4 papers), Recycled Aggregate Concrete Performance (4 papers) and Photorefractive and Nonlinear Optics (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(208 citations), Civil and Structural Engineering (265 citations), Building and Construction (162 citations), Polymers and Plastics (110 citations) and Mechanical Engineering (297 citations). Yuzhou Wang has collaborated with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Yuxi Zhao, Jianfeng Dong, Na Han, Xingxiang Zhang, Ruirui Cao, Sai Chen, Haihui Liu, Ligang Peng, Sisi Liu and Xinyi Sun. Their work appears in journals such as Energy and Buildings, Journal of Building Engineering, Microchemical Journal, Advanced Materials and Progress in Nuclear Energy.
